PA DCED Helping to Provide New Housing for Harrisburg's Homeless

Published in Law and Health Weekly, February 14th, 2009

Many of the Harrisburg region's homeless residents will soon have a warm, safe place to stay through the help of a new state investment, Department of Community and Economic Development Deputy Secretary Ken Klothen said.

"Susquehanna Harbor Safe Haven will truly live up to its name because it will be a secure place for some of Dauphin County's homeless residents to stay while they get their lives back in order," said Klothen, DCED's deputy secretary for community affairs and development. "The facility will also help to reduce the county's homeless population."
